Course Content

• Quantum Computing Fundamentals for Neuroscience
• Quantum Algorithms and their Neuroscientific Applications
• Quantum Machine Learning in Brain-Computer Interfaces
• Quantum Simulation of Neural Networks
• Advanced Quantum Information Theory for Neuroscience
• Quantum Entanglement and its Role in Neural Processes
• Quantum Annealing for Optimization Problems in Neuroscience
• Quantum Key Distribution and its implications for Brain Data Security
